Manchester bus driver to be charged

2012-02-08 12:13:03 | (0 Comments)


Dave Lindo, Gleaner Writer

The driver of minibus believed to be responsible for yesterday’s tragic bus crash in Manchester is yet to be charged.

The Manchester Traffic Department said the driver, whose name is being withheld, remains hospitalized with broken legs.

The police say he is to be charged with dangerous driving, disobeying the continuous white line and carrying excess passengers.

The driver is accused of wrongly overtaking which resulted in a head-on collision.

A total of 51 persons were injured, the majority of them being students.
